Culture eats strategy for breakfast and your best trainer might be the problem. The number one people issue we hear in the SPF is "this person is amazing at their job but they're a terrible culture fit." Nine times out of ten the answer is to let them go. You can teach someone to coach a squat. You cannot teach someone to be a good person. Hire for character, train for skill. Keep the lowest heart rate in the room. The chain linking your current product to your current price is bigger and thicker in your mind than in your customers'. I raised prices $49 across the board on members who have been with me for nearly two decades. It added over $7,300 in monthly recurring revenue overnight with zero increase in expenses. A gym owner stuck at $13K hit $20K in 2 months instead of 12 by raising prices . At his current churn and acquisition rates, it would have taken him a full year to grow from 50 to 75 members. Instead we raised prices $40 a month on current and new members and he got there in weeks. Speed matters. Switch to 28 day billing and you get a 13th payment every year. On 100 members at $200 a month, that's an extra $20,000 in annual revenue for changing one setting in your billing software. There are empty spots in your current sessions that are pure profit. If you're running sessions at 3 out of 6 and you fill one more spot, that's zero additional expense and 100% margin. Track your capacity weekly and you'll find money you didn't know was there. Learn the skill of generating a cash flow surge. When your water heater breaks or you get an unexpected bill, you need to be able to go out and create money. We also get into why staff retention is the number one driver of client retention, how to catch the warning signs before a member cancels, why boredom and injuries quietly kill your revenue, and the one question you should be asking every new member on day one. 5 Key Takeaways: Staff retention is the number one driver of client retention. When key staff members leave, clients follow. Your job as the owner is to treat your team well, create opportunities for growth, and build a structure where the client has a relationship with the business, not just one trainer. Members leave when they feel ignored. If someone misses a session and nobody calls, they start to believe it doesn't matter whether they show up or not. Track attendance, follow up on missed sessions, and make it part of your culture that people know you're paying attention. A 1% improvement in churn is worth real money. On a 150 member gym at $400 a month, the difference between 5% and 4% attrition is $30,000 a year. That's money you earn without getting a single new lead. Boredom kills retention just as much as bad results. If your programming feels like the same thing every week, people disengage. Build in variety, give options, create internal challenges and events that members look forward to throughout the year. Ask "what does success look like for you" on day one, then follow up on it. If someone told you they wanted to lose 10 pounds and three months later nobody's checked in on that, they'll quietly cancel and go try something else. The 30 day check in call is one of the simplest retention tools you can put in place. They were putting all their eggs into one marketing basket. Tom and I break down a concept I picked up from a $4,300 phone call with Dan Kennedy called "fertile soil." The idea is simple. When you first start marketing in a niche or platform, you're digging in soft, loose soil. Easy customers. But the longer you stay on one platform without diversifying, the deeper you dig. The soil gets harder. The leads get worse. And eventually you're hitting concrete. The fix isn't to get better at sales. The fix is to find new ponds. There's a lesson in there for every gym owner. 5 Key Takeaways: Your show rate problem might be a marketing problem. If all your leads come from one source and that source has been drying up, getting better at sales won't fix it. You need to find new pockets of fertile soil where higher quality prospects are waiting. 20 to 30% of leads showing up for a consultation is a solid show rate. If your number is way higher than that, you probably don't have enough lead volume. If it's way lower, it might be your source, not your skills. Reactivation is one of the most overlooked ponds you already have. If you've been in business 10 years with a 5% churn rate, you've lost over 1,200 people. Text 10 to 15 of them a month with a personal message. Not a template. A real conversation. The best joint ventures come from getting the referral source into your gym as a client.
